COOKING TIPS
In the kitchen.
- 1Do not overcook as ground ham is already cured and can become very dry
- 2Be cautious with adding extra salt to recipes as ham is naturally high in sodium
- 3Excellent for ham loaves, ham salad, or as a savory addition to pasta sauces

FAQ
Frequently asked questions.
How long does ground ham last in the fridge?
Freshly ground ham should be used within 3 to 5 days when st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ator.
Can I freeze ground ham?
Yes, ground ham freezes well. For best quality, use it within 1 to 2 months of freezing.
What is a good substitute for ground ham?
Ground pork mixed with a bit of liquid smoke and extra salt, or finely minced Canadian bacon can serve as substitutes.
Is ground ham already cooked?
Most ground ham is made from cured ham which is technically cooked, but it should still be heated to an internal temperature of 160°F (71°C) for safety.
How do I know if ground ham has gone bad?
Discard ground ham if it has a sour smell, a slimy texture, or if the color has turned grey or green.
Is ground ham high in sodium?
Yes, because ham is a cured meat, ground ham contains significantly higher sodium levels than fresh ground pork.
What are common uses for ground ham?
It is commonly used in ham salad, ham loaves, stuffed peppers, or mixed into breakfast casseroles.
Does ground ham contain gluten?
Pure ground ham is gluten-free, but some pre-packaged versions may contain fillers or flavorings that include gluten. Always check the label.
How should I prep ground ham for cooking?
Since it is already ground, no special prep is needed. Simply incorporate it directly into your recipe.
Can I use ground ham in place of ground beef?
You can, but the flavor profile will be much saltier and smokier. It works best when mixed with other meats like ground pork or beef.
